Scotland Game On
22 Nov 2008
The Scotland team will face Canada at Pittodrie today with Aberdeen serving up a dusting of snow but Scottish Rugby would like to assure fans that today’s game will go ahead. Groundsmen at Pittodrie Stadium have been working overnight to ensure that the pitch is in a playable condition for today’s Bank of Scotland Corporate Autumn Test match against Canada – including painting the pitch markings bright red for increased visibility. Undersoil heating, a requirement of all SPL clubs, has ensured that the ground has remained soft despite the snowfall. Grampian Police match commander and the Aberdeen FC safety officer have both looked at the pitch this morning and the game will go ahead. Scotland team (sponsor Murray) to play Canada in the Bank of Scotland Corporate Autumn Test Pittodrie, Aberdeen, on Saturday 22 November (kick-off 2.45pm) 15 Rory Lamont (Sale Sharks) 14 Simon Webster (Edinburgh) 13 Ben Cairns (Edinburgh) 12 Nick De Luca (Edinburgh) 11 Nikki Walker (Ospreys) 10 Phil Godman (Edinburgh) 9 Mike Blair (Edinburgh) CAPTAIN 1 Allan Jacobsen (Edinburgh) 2 Ross Ford (Edinburgh) 3 Euan Murray (Northampton Saints) 4 Nathan Hines (Perpignan) 5 Jim Hamilton (Edinburgh) 6 Alasdair Strokosch (Gloucester) 8 Simon Taylor (Stade Francais) 7 John Barclay (Glasgow Warriors) Substitutes 16 Dougie Hall (Glasgow Warriors) 17 Alasdair Dickinson (Gloucester) 18 Matt Mustchin (Edinburgh) 19 Scott Gray (Northampton Saints) 20 Rory Lawson (Gloucester) 21 Dan Parks (Glasgow Warriors) 22 Max Evans (Glasgow Warriors)
